The Manufacturing Process
Once the quote is accepted and the deposit is paid:
-
Final design is confirmed
-
A prototype is made for fit & comfort
-
Components are sculpted and moulded
-
Fabrics are sourced and printed
-
Costume is assembled and detailed
-
Branding is added
-
Final fitting and quality checks
​
Photos are sent for approval before delivery.

Our Mascot Heads
Our heads are:
​
-
Lightweight
-
Durable
-
Hygienic
-
Easy to clean
​
They’re made using thermo-forming (not fibreglass), with:
-
Adjustable internal helmet
-
Hidden ventilation
-
Optional fan-assisted cooling
-
Clear, safe vision
​
Built for long-term professional use.
